The Liebster Award

The Liebster Award

This award is something that bloggers award to other bloggers. It is a way to connect within our community and support each other. It is for small blogs that are just starting out, with less than 200 readers. The Liebster award is a way to discover new blogs.

The award started in 2011. According to The Global Aussie “Liebster in German means sweetest, kindest, nicest, dearest, beloved, lovely, kind, pleasant, valued, cute, endearing, and welcome.”

The winner is chosen base day on questions asked, presentation,and spirit on December 31, 2017.

If you are nominated and chose to accept, this is what you need to do next:

1. Thank the person who nominated you and link back to their blog. Promoting them a little is kind, and those who you nominate can do the same for you.

2. Display the award on your blog. You can simply include it in the post. Find the image options Here

3. Write a 150-300 word post about your favorite blog. Include links.

4. Provide 10 random facts about yourself.

5. Nominate 5-11 blogs that you feel deserve the award. They MUST have less than 200 readers.

6. List the rules for you nominees to read, or link back to the original page with them so they are easily accessible.

7. After you publish your post, inform the people/blogs you nominated for the Liebster award. Provide them a link to your post so they have all the information they need.

8. Leave a comment with your post on The Global Aussie
